## Deploying the Gatewick Proctor Queue

Deploys are pretty painless: push to main, wait for the pipeline, then watch the queue drain dashboard for five minutes. If candidates pile up mid-exam, roll back first and ask questions later — the queue replays safely. Everything the workers care about lives in one config block, shown here for reference.

settings of bafof-yagef:
JOROX_PIN=8740
JOROX_TENANT=pelox
JOROX_METRICS_HOST=metrics.jorox.qorvelworks.internal
JOROX_SEAL=seal_c78f63c1
JOROX_STANDBY_TEAM=norax

Ticket #4417 — Retention sweeper go-live

The Mossvale retention sweeper is ready to start hard-deleting records older than 36 months from the archive tier. Dry-run logs look clean, and the exclusion list for legal holds is wired in. Before we flip it to destructive mode, we need a security sign-off from the person below.

named custodian: Brivan Eliath Quenox Frador

## Runbook: Flaky DNS in Quellhaven Staging

The Marrowlane resolver intermittently returns stale records for the ingest nodes, causing timeouts in the Pellit sync job. Restarting the cache daemon clears it for roughly an hour. Until the upstream fix lands, pin the fallback resolver in the service env file. Add the signing credential for the fallback endpoint on the next line.

env line for fafof-fahag: LEDGER_TOKEN5=f8790

Facilities ticket — Night shift, Brindlecote Campus. Twenty-two interns from the Fennhollow programme arrive tomorrow at 08:00. Please unlock seminar rooms B2 and B3 by 06:30, set chairs to classroom layout, and confirm the water coolers on level one are refilled. Leave the loading bay clear for their equipment van. Overnight access to the prep corridor requires the pass code below.

badge for bajop-yawep: bdg-NNHEW-6